Detailed Engineering Specifications

Manufactured under strict quality controls, this 0.786-inch thick stock sheet boasts a robust 316 stainless steel composition, renowned for its enhanced molybdenum content, providing superior resistance to pitting and crevice corrosion. With dimensions of 37 inches in length and 30 inches in width, it offers a substantial surface area suitable for fabrication into components used in highly corrosive or saline environments. The material's inherent passivity and low magnetic permeability make it ideal for demanding industrial and marine applications where component integrity is paramount.

Mechanical Properties

Tensile Strength75,000 psi (515 MPa)
Yield Strength30,000 psi (205 MPa)
Elongation in 2 in.40% min
HardnessRockwell B95 max

Chemical Composition

Carbon (C)0.08% max
Chromium (Cr)16.0 - 18.0%
Nickel (Ni)10.0 - 14.0%
Molybdenum (Mo)2.0 - 3.0%
